 * Housing:
 How satisfied were you with your living arrangements?  | 
 Very nice, apartment style dorms  | 
| * Food: | 
 The food was great, but there were not a ton of places to eat cheaply and there was not a dining hall/meal plan that I know about. There were some good cafes on campus that were fun to go to, and there was a super market a bus ride away.  |

 * Social & Cultural Integration:
 How integrated did you feel with the local culture?  | 
 Somewhat, but being up on the mountain also kept you somewhat separated. The events the school held helped though!  | 
| 
 * Health Care:
 How well were health issues addressed during the program?  | 
 School provided health care, which was nice  | 
| * Safety: | 
 Very safe, checkpoints all over campus. When national tensions heightened security got tighter.  |
